Biografia

Vetusta Morla is a Spanish indie rock band formed in Tres Cantos, near Madrid, in 2002. Composed of Juan Manuel Latorre (vocals), Rafa Valdivielso (guitar), Diego Rodríguez (bass) and Andrés Martín (drums), the group quickly gained a large fanbase thanks to their sound characterized by melancholic atmospheres, poetic lyrics and complex arrangements. Vetusta Morla has established itself as one of the most important indie rock bands in contemporary Spain, with successful albums such as "Copenhague" (2010), "Mapas" (2013) and "Mismo sitio, distinto lugar" (2016). Their best-known songs include "El alma de la fiesta", "La deriva", "Ojalá" and "Los días que me faltan". Vetusta Morla is known for its intense and emotional concerts, which have led the group to perform at international festivals.
